Willco Inc. manufactures electronic parts. They are analyzing their monthly maintenance costs to determine the best way to budge

t these costs in the future. They have collected the following data for the last six months.
Month Machine hours Maintenance cost
January 61500 125,000
February 82,000 15,1500
March 76000 132,400
APril 75400 40500
May 86300 151000
June 71750 122600
Using the high-low method and the Willco data, calculate the variable maintenance cost per machine hour (round to three decimal places).
a. $0.913/hr.
b. $1.048/hr.
c. $1.069/hr.
d. $1.848/hr.
e. $1.293/hr.

Answer:

Variable cost per unit= $1.048

Explanation:

Giving the following information:

Highest activity cost= $151,000

Highest activity units= 86,300

Lowest activity cost= $125,000

Lowest activity units= 61,500

<u>To calculate the variable cost under the high-low method, we need to use the following formula:</u>

Variable cost per unit= (Highest activity cost - Lowest activity cost)/ (Highest activity units - Lowest activity units)

Variable cost per unit=  (151,000 - 125,000) / (86,300 - 61,500)

Variable cost per unit= $1.048
